Sarah Ferguson Pays Tribute to Queen Camilla in Heartfelt World Book Day Message

Duchess of York echoes Queen’s passion for literacy in meaningful statement

Sarah Ferguson has followed in the footsteps of Queen Camilla as she marked World Book Day with a heartfelt message celebrating the power of storytelling.

The Duchess of York shared delightful throwback photos from her book launch events, highlighting her love for literature and commitment to promoting reading among all age groups.

Similarly, Queen Camilla marked the occasion by releasing a special video message from a Buckingham Palace event, where she hosted the finalists of the BBC 500 Words competition alongside their families and celebrity guests.

Sarah, who shares Camilla’s dedication to fostering a love of books, posted an inspiring note on social media.

"Happy #WorldBookDay! Books have the power to transport us to new worlds, spark imagination, and inspire a lifelong love of learning. Today we celebrate the magic of storytelling and the joy that reading brings to people of all ages," she wrote.

Reflecting on her own journey as an author, she added:

"As an author, I’ve been privileged to write stories that encourage curiosity and creativity, and one of my greatest joys is sharing them with children around the world."

Encouraging people of all ages to embrace reading, she concluded:

"Let today be a reminder of the joy of reading. Pick up a book, get lost in a story, and celebrate the magic of words."

Her message closely aligns with Queen Camilla’s ongoing efforts to champion literacy, reinforcing their shared passion for the written word.
